four time ABA champ on his comeback - got stopped in nottingham last night....anyone see what happened???
shocking result.
Posted: 10 Nov 2007, 08:59
by rhino222
watched it from ringside stood chatting to michael monaghan, kelly was caught in the first and dropped, he got up and weathered the storm and indeed nearly stopped his man in the 3rd i think it was, kelly was the better boxer by far but kept walking onto big looping right hands from a tired and desperate opponent.
kelly was stopped on his feet in the 5th i think it was.
